We are working with a London based consultancy who are supporting a major client in the insurance sector. They are looking for an experienced Security Operations Manager to lead and mature their security operations capability on an initial contract basis.
This role will suit someone who is hands-on but also comfortable operating at a strategic level, driving improvements across security monitoring, incident response, and operational resilience.
Key Responsibilities- Lead and manage day-to-day security operations, including SOC activities and incident response
- Oversee detection and response capabilities, ensuring effective monitoring and alerting
- Drive continuous improvement across security tooling, processes, and playbooks
- Act as the escalation point for major security incidents
- Work closely with internal stakeholders and third parties to ensure alignment with security objectives
- Support regulatory and compliance requirements relevant to the insurance sector
- Provide reporting and insights to senior stakeholders on security posture and risks
- Proven experience in a Security Operations Manager or similar leadership role
- Strong background in SOC operations, SIEM, and incident response
- Experience working within regulated environments, ideally insurance or financial services
- Ability to balance strategic oversight with hands-on technical input
- Excellent stakeholder management and communication skills
- Experience working within consultancy environments is advantageous
